Priyanka Gandhi launched a sharp critique of Prime Minister Narendra Modi during a parliamentary session, alleging a disconnect between the administration’s curated public image and its handling of civil unrest.

Gandhi specifically targeted the government’s response to student protests and the deployment of high-grade weaponry against civilians. She highlighted the use of pellet guns and AK-47s, arguing that the state’s reliance on force reflects a failure in governance and empathy.

During her address, Gandhi used the phrase “change dil ka angle, not camera angle,” suggesting that the Prime Minister is more focused on the optics of his leadership and the precision of his public presentations than on the actual grievances of the citizenry.

Analysis:
Gandhi’s rhetoric focuses on a perceived disparity between the “camera angle”—the carefully managed image of the Prime Minister—and the “dil ka angle,” or the emotional and human reality of those affected by state policy. By citing specific weaponry like AK-47s and pellet guns, she is attempting to shift the narrative from political disagreement to a question of human rights and institutional accountability. This strategy aims to frame the current administration as prioritizing superficial image management over the substantive resolution of social and student-led unrest.
